...Gusty winds early this evening...

Scattered showers will continue pushing southeast into the area
early this evening. As these showers weaken with the loss of
daytime heating, there will be the potential for some to produce
wind gusts near 50 to 55 MPH. These gusty winds could blow around
unsecured objects.
